    There’s a big difference between 1200 calories if you are a petite women (can be plenty), versus a physically fit 6’0 man who works out regularly (1200 is not plenty for most). A lot of women (e.g., taller ones, really active individuals, etc.) also cannot sustain well on 1200 calories.

    There are definitely people who can eat 1200 and be fine, but also plenty cannot. It’s understanding your body and your needs to determine if 1200 is an acceptable calorie target for you.
